Position Overview: The Contractor Sales Manager is responsible for leading revenue growth with HomeServe’s third-party contractor network by growing and optimizing the contractor referral program and new/existing contractor benefit rebate programs. This role ensures that third-party contractors are effectively incentivized to refer HomeServe repair plans while maintaining an exceptional customer experience. The Manager is also responsible for developing the systems, dashboards, and metrics necessary to track referral performance and rebate growth, providing the leadership required to improve performance and meet specific growth targets on an annual basis. This role will report to the Director, Contractor Recruiting, Sales & Administration.

Responsibilities

  • Referral Growth: Oversee the end-to-end performance of the contractor referral sales channel, ensuring revenue targets are met through strategic engagement.
  • Rebate Performance: Manage and optimize contractor benefit participation and rebate growth, while analyzing performance data to ensure Onboarding Specialists are driving the desired sales behaviors.
  • Contractor Incentives: Oversee referral fee structures and benefit tiers to ensure third-party contractors are compensated timely and appropriately in line with standard operating procedures.
  • Stakeholder Support: Support the Contractor Management team with growing the programs through the distribution of marketing materials, webinars, on-site training, and any other appropriate means.
  • Contractor Relations: Drive deep relationships with contractor partners, regional operations management and the recruiting/onboarding team to expand the referral network and grow plan sales.
  • Product Voice: Participate in new product roadmap discussions to ensure offerings align with what contractors are motivated to refer, and that the customer journey is optimized to eliminate friction points.
  • Dashboards & Metrics: Own the referral sales and rebate performance dashboards for Monthly Business Reviews (MBR), highlighting referral conversion rates and rebate utilization.
  • Strategic Planning: Develop multi-year strategies to significantly scale the referral network and benefit programs.
  • Market Dynamics: Maintain an expert understanding of contractor profiles, sales profiles, and performance trending to grow all aspects of the referral and benefit programs.
  • Referral & Rebate Oversight: Managing referral sales activation and participation rates, auditing rebate eligibility, and optimizing performance.
  • Field Engagement: Supporting Regional Operations Managers (ROM) and third-party contractors with webinars, on-site training, marketing material, and program communications to grow revenue and achieve annual growth targets.
  • Strategic Planning & Analytics: Developing long-term growth strategies, financial forecasting, and managing the rebate dashboards and performance reporting.
  • Operational Reporting: Developing and maintaining dashboards; conducting monthly business reviews with executive leadership.
